If you know you want to apply for a home loan, get ready way before you plan on doing it. Get your budget completed and your financial documents in hand. This means you should save a bit of money while getting debts under control. If you wait too long to do these things, you may not be approved for a home mortgage.

Before you try and get a mortgage, you should go over your credit report to see if you have things in order. The ringing in of 2013 meant even stricter credit standards than in the past, so you need to clean up your credit rating as much as possible in order to qualify for the best mortgage terms.
Gather your documents before making application for a home loan. This information is vital to the mortgage process that your lender will look at. Some of them include W2s, bank statements, pay stubs and your income tax returns for the past few years. If you have the documents in hand, you won't have to return later with them.

A good rule of thumb is to allow up to 30% of your earnings to be spent on your monthly mortgage payment. If it is, then you may find it difficult to pay your mortgage over time. Your budget will stay in order when you manage your payments well.
Don't give up hope if your loan application is denied. Try another lender to apply to, instead. Each lender can set its own criteria for granting loans. Therefore, it may be beneficial to you to apply with a few mortgage lenders for best results.

Put all of your paperwork together before visiting a lender. Your lender requires that you show them proof of income along with financial statements and additional assets that you may have. If you have what you need before you go, you will get approved much quicker than you would have otherwise.
Think about finding a consultant for going through the lending process. There is much information to learn before you get a home mortgage, and the consultant can guide you to getting the best deal. They will also help you to be sure that you're getting a fair deal from everyone involved in the process.
Before you sign the dotted line on your refinanced mortgage, be sure to get full disclosure of all costs involved in writing. This ought to encompass closing costs and other fees. There could be hidden charges that you aren't aware of.
Speak with many lenders before selecting the one you want to borrow from. Read up on the reputations of the potential lenders, any hidden fees, and their rates. After having a good understanding of everything involved, then you can select the right mortgage option for you.

Mortgage lenders want you to have lower balances across the board, not big ones on a couple of accounts. Try to keep your balances below 50 percent of your credit limit. Keeping your balances under 30% of your credit limit is even better.
Work with mortgage brokers if you have trouble getting a loan from a credit union or bank. A broker might be able to help you find something that fits your circumstances. They check out multiple lenders on your behalf and help you choose the best option.
Learn what all goes into getting a mortgage in terms of fees. During the close, you might be amazed at the number of associated fees. It can be quite confusing and annoying. You will understand the language by doing some homework, so you will be more prepared to negotiate.
Tell the truth. Inaccurate information, whether intentional or unintentional, can result in a denial of your loan. Your mortgage lender will do the homework and find out the truth.
A good credit score generally leads to a great mortgage rate. Request a copy of your credit report from all three credit reporting agencies, and check to make sure it is accurate. A score under 620 is no longer acceptable for many banks now a days.
The interest rate on your loan is important, however it's not the only thing to consider. Each lender has different fee structures. Think about the types of available loans, expenses associated with closing a mortgage loan and points that you may need to pay to bring your interest rate down. Obtain quotes from a variety of lenders and banks before deciding.
Getting prequalified for your mortgage makes a great impression to sellers and demonstrates your seriousness. It shows your finances have been reviewed and approved. But, be sure that your approval letter shows the exact funds to match your offer. If you are approved for a larger amount, the seller may want to demand more money.

Build your relationship with your current financial institution ahead of buying a home. You may find it helpful to get a personal loan and pay it off before making a home loan application. This shows your bank that you are reliable with payments.
Don't be scared to wait for a better loan. Different times of each year can present different rates. You may locate an option that works well since a new company is having a deal or the government has passed something new. Just remember that waiting may be in your best interest.
